Why exactly does the government have such a high interest in small businesses? Small businesses likely represent ninety five percent of all employers in the United States. In addition, they contribute 50 percent of the gross domestic product of the country. Grants for small businesses are offered to business owners to promote economic improvement or growth. Three of four new American jobs are offered by small businesses.

The United States government doesn’t actually give out federal grant money to begin a small business. The Small Business Administration (SBA) is a Federal government agency that supports, protects the interests of, advocates, and provides resources small business concerns. The federal government has left it up to each individual state to appropriate funding by way of state grants to assist small businesses to thrive and grow. Think government grants and loans are a fantasy or only for the extremely disadvantaged? Not so. The government gives out millions of dollars in grants each year and even much more in low interest loans to people who have a need that meets the government’s guidelines. So just what things does the government give grants and loans for? Everything from company start up and expansion to help with rent and utility charges. There are a number of government agencies that get capital every year to give or loan out to individuals needing their services.

If you’re interested in starting a company, you might wish to check out the SBA’s site to find if you will discover any grants or loans obtainable through them. Minorities and women have a good chance to get these forms of grants and loans. While there aren’t quite a few grants offered for organization start up by way of the authorities, you might be eligible for a reduced interest loan by the Small business administration or your nearby bank. At this time, you’ll find no federal grants given for small business start ups.

Government grants and loans are also provided to men and women wishing to further their education but are not able to afford the high costs of college on their own. The federal government makes these resources available to people who are applying to most any public school within the USA. Any person who fulfills the earnings requirements can make use of a Free Application For Student Aide or FAFSA form to apply for PELL grants and low interest student loans. You can apply for grants and loans to assist defer educational costs by visiting your institution’s student aide department or by visiting fafsa.org.

If finances are tight and you are having problems paying your rent and/or utilities each month, you will qualify for one or several government grants and loans offered for this specific purpose. Federal, state and local governments contribute finances each and every year to assist low income or disadvantaged persons with utility bills, as well as with rent fees. Your nearby Department of Social Services can help you with applications for utilities grants and might have finances available for rent help also. The US Department of Housing and Urban Development, also known as HUD, also has grant resources offered to aid with housing fees if you meet the requirements.
